The Xiaomi 17 Pro embodies sophistication with its Dragon Crystal Glass front and an aluminum frame, providing a solid yet elegant feel. It weighs 192 grams and measures 151.1 x 71.8 x 8 mm, offering a compact yet premium grip. The phone also carries an IP68 rating, ensuring dust resistance and water protection for up to 30 minutes in depths of 4 meters — ideal for those who value durability alongside luxury.
Xiaomi has taken display innovation to new heights with a dual LTPO AMOLED setup. The main 6.3-inch display delivers 68 billion colors, Dolby Vision, HDR Vivid, HDR10+, and an incredible 3500 nits peak brightness, ensuring vibrant visuals and smooth motion at 120Hz.
The surprise addition is the 2.7-inch secondary LTPO AMOLED screen on the back, which also supports 120Hz refresh rate, HDR formats, and the same brightness level. This makes it perfect for quick selfies, notifications, and creative photography. Both displays are protected by Xiaomi’s Dragon Crystal Glass, making them durable against scratches and impacts.
Under the hood, the Xiaomi 17 Pro is fueled by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 (3nm) chipset, paired with the powerful Adreno 840 GPU. This configuration ensures ultra-smooth multitasking, gaming, and AI-driven performance. The CPU features Oryon V3 Phoenix cores that reach up to 4.6 GHz, setting a new benchmark for Android flagships.
Running on Android 16 with HyperOS 3, users get a refined, smooth, and customizable software experience optimized for power efficiency and speed.

The Xiaomi 17 Pro doesn’t compromise on sound quality. It features stereo speakers with Dolby Atmos, Hi-Res Audio certification, and Snapdragon Sound support for immersive listening. Connectivity options include Wi-Fi 7, Bluetooth 5.4, NFC, infrared, and Ultra Wideband (UWB) — making it future-ready for smart ecosystems.
Powering the Xiaomi 17 Pro is a robust 6300mAh Si/C Li-Ion battery, supported by 100W wired charging, 50W wireless, and 22.5W reverse wireless charging. With support for PD3.0, QC3+, and PPS standards, it can fully charge in just minutes, keeping you connected all day long.
